Glashütte Limburg pendant lamp, dating from 1970-1979, designed by Hans-Agne Jakobsson. This lamp stands out for its high-quality handmade construction and minimalist design. The octagonal glass lampshade appears to be divided into individual panels. It emits exceptional light, creating beautiful shadows (see photos). The mounting bracket is made of brass. Its design incorporates elements of outdoor lanterns, combined with a clean geometric structure. The lamp is in original condition, showing only very slight signs of wear. A classic of German design from the 1970s. Dimensions: Total height approx. 70 cm with cable, lamp 40 cm. Lampshade width: approx. 26 cm. Depth 26 cm. E27 metal socket - LED compatible, designed for 220 V. The lamp has been tested and its proper functioning has been verified.
